    Behind the Scenes: How WLKY Predicts the Weather

    So, how does the WLKY weather team actually put together your local forecast? It's a fascinating process that combines science, technology, and a deep understanding of local weather patterns. These guys don't just look out the window and guess! Here's a peek behind the curtain:

    Data Collection: The process begins with gathering massive amounts of data from various sources. This includes surface observations from weather stations, readings from weather balloons, and data from satellites orbiting the Earth. Each of these sources provides different pieces of the puzzle, giving meteorologists a comprehensive view of the current atmospheric conditions. Surface observations provide real-time data on temperature, humidity, wind speed, and precipitation. Weather balloons carry instruments high into the atmosphere to measure temperature, pressure, and wind at different altitudes. Satellites provide a bird's-eye view of cloud cover, precipitation patterns, and other weather phenomena. All this data is fed into complex computer models that simulate the behavior of the atmosphere.

    Weather Models: These sophisticated computer programs use mathematical equations to predict how the atmosphere will evolve over time. Meteorologists at WLKY use a variety of weather models, each with its strengths and weaknesses. By comparing the outputs of different models, they can get a better sense of the range of possible outcomes. Some models are better at predicting temperature, while others are more accurate at forecasting precipitation. The meteorologists use their expertise to evaluate the models and determine which ones are most reliable for the specific weather situation. The models take into account a wide range of factors, including temperature, pressure, humidity, wind speed, and solar radiation. They also consider the topography of the land, as mountains and valleys can have a significant impact on local weather patterns.

    Local Expertise: This is where the WLKY weather team truly shines. They understand the unique weather patterns of the Louisville area, which are influenced by its geography and proximity to major weather systems. They know how the Ohio River affects local humidity, how the surrounding hills can create localized temperature variations, and how weather systems moving across the country tend to behave as they approach the region. This local knowledge allows them to fine-tune the forecasts generated by the weather models, making them more accurate and relevant to the community.     Why Local Weather Matters

    Why is having a dedicated, local weather team like the one at WLKY so important? Well, weather isn't just about knowing whether to grab an umbrella. It impacts nearly every aspect of our lives. Local weather forecasts are essential for various reasons, including:

    Safety: Accurate weather information can help people prepare for severe weather events like thunderstorms, tornadoes, and floods. This can save lives and prevent injuries. When severe weather threatens, the WLKY weather team provides timely warnings and updates, giving people the information they need to stay safe. They work closely with local emergency management agencies to ensure that the community is prepared for any type of weather emergency. They also use their expertise to explain the risks associated with different types of weather, such as the dangers of driving in heavy rain or the importance of seeking shelter during a tornado.

    Planning: Knowing the forecast allows individuals and businesses to plan their activities accordingly. This can range from deciding what to wear to scheduling outdoor events to making logistical arrangements for transportation and deliveries. Farmers rely on accurate weather forecasts to make decisions about planting, harvesting, and irrigation. Construction companies use weather forecasts to schedule outdoor work and ensure the safety of their workers. Event organizers use weather forecasts to plan outdoor events and make contingency plans in case of inclement weather. The WLKY weather team provides detailed forecasts that help people make informed decisions about their daily activities.

    Economic Impact: Weather can have a significant impact on the local economy. Extreme weather events can cause damage to property, disrupt transportation, and force businesses to close. Accurate weather forecasts can help businesses prepare for these events and minimize their losses. For example, a hardware store might stock up on snow shovels and ice melt before a winter storm, or a restaurant might adjust its menu based on the forecast temperature. Farmers can use weather forecasts to optimize their crop yields and minimize their losses from pests and diseases.
